Expand Map
Optical Goods in Glidden, IA
1. Walmart - Vision Center
2014 Kittyhawk Rd, Carroll, IA 51401
OPEN NOW:9:00 am - 7:00 pm
2. Whylie Eye Care Center
501 N Adams St, Carroll, IA 51401
3. McIntosh, William E, OD
805 N Main St, Carroll, IA 51401
5. Craig S Rock OD
913 N Woodlawn Ave, Lake City, IA 51449
Showing 1-5 of 5